Why So Many Artist Portfolios Stay Invisible

One of the biggest misconceptions in the creative industry is the idea that posting consistently is enough. Many artists upload artwork regularly but never develop a clear identity or strategy behind their presentation.

Potential clients and collectors do not simply buy artwork. They buy emotion, storytelling, personality, and connection. When a portfolio lacks direction, visitors often leave without remembering the artist behind the work.

Several common issues make portfolios disappear in the endless noise online:

• No clear artistic identity
• Weak portfolio structure
• Inconsistent visual branding
• Little or no audience engagement
• Poor SEO optimization
• Irregular updates
• Generic artist descriptions
• No strategic use of social media

Without intentional marketing for artists, even impressive portfolios can remain buried beneath millions of competing pages.

Your Portfolio Is More Than a Gallery

A successful portfolio should not function as a random collection of images. It should guide visitors through a carefully designed experience.

Think about how people react when they land on your website. Within seconds, they subconsciously ask themselves several questions:

• What makes this artist different?
• What emotions does this work create?
• Is this artist professional?
• Why should I follow or remember them?
• Can I trust them for commissions or purchases?

If the answers are unclear, visitors usually leave quickly.

Professional artists understand that branding matters. The strongest portfolios communicate a recognizable atmosphere, style, and voice. Colors, typography, descriptions, project organization, and storytelling all contribute to how people perceive the artist behind the work.

Strong marketing for artists helps transform a simple portfolio into a memorable personal brand.

The Power of Storytelling in the Art Industry

People remember stories far more than isolated images.

A portfolio becomes dramatically more engaging when visitors understand the meaning behind the artwork, the inspiration driving the creator, or the journey behind a collection. Storytelling creates emotional investment, and emotional investment leads to engagement.

Instead of uploading artwork with minimal descriptions, artists should explain:

• The idea behind the project
• The emotions explored in the work
• The creative process
• Personal inspiration
• Challenges overcome during creation
• The message intended for viewers

This approach not only improves audience connection but also supports SEO performance. Search engines increasingly reward meaningful, high-quality written content that provides context and value.

Modern marketing for artists combines visual impact with compelling written communication.

SEO Matters More Than Most Artists Realize

Search engine optimization is no longer just for large companies. Artists who ignore SEO often lose enormous opportunities for organic traffic.

When someone searches for specific artistic styles, commissions, digital illustration services, or creative inspiration, optimized content can help artists appear directly in search results.

An effective artist website should include:

• Keyword-optimized page titles
• Clear headings
• Descriptive image alt text
• Fast loading speed
• Mobile-friendly design
• Original written content
• Internal linking between pages
• Consistent blog updates

The keyword marketing for artists itself reflects a growing trend. More creators now understand that visibility depends not only on artistic quality but also on discoverability.

Artists who actively publish articles, behind-the-scenes insights, tutorials, or creative thoughts often perform far better online than artists who only upload finished images.

Social Media Alone Is Not Enough

Many creators depend entirely on platforms like Instagram or TikTok for exposure. While social media can be powerful, relying on algorithms alone is risky.

Platforms constantly change their visibility rules. One month an artist may receive strong engagement, while the next month their reach collapses without explanation.

A professional portfolio website provides stability and ownership. Unlike social platforms, your website belongs entirely to you.

The most successful artists use social media as a gateway rather than a destination. They attract attention through short-form content while directing audiences toward their main portfolio, newsletter, or professional platform.

This balanced strategy is essential in modern marketing for artists.
